I.M. Maillette clrc#37300
Maillette  won second in her very large class of browns at Alpaca Ontario 2009. The judge observed that she was the ideal type of girl for a breeding programme. She is a large solid boned individual and the carbon copy of her elder sister Twickle, who is also on the farm. She halters extremely well, and produces a full long fleece with substantial coverage and a constant medium brown colour. An excellent example of an alpaca, she has been bred to Sombrero for a late 2010 cria, but  is not as yet confirmed pregnant. An absolute bargain at $3,000.

Twickle clrc#35192

Twickle was the first cria born on our farm, and we are proud to say she was the first homebred to produce a cria when she gave birth to little Sawyers this summer. Twickle is the most elegant alpaca, an absolute joy to handle and a very conscientious first time mother Her fibre characteristics are identical to her full sister Maillette , whose qualities have already been recognised in the showring. This very special alpaca has been bred to Sombrero for a 2010 cria. Twickle is for sale for $3,000

Charo's Shining Star clrc# 24902
Star, pictured between her daughter Lavender and new born son Spike in May 2009, is a prolific producer of substantial high quality cria. A tough and no nonsense mum who births very easily, Star would be the matriarch in any herd  that Lily was not in. She still retains bundles of fibre and sheared seven pounds in 2009. Our herd is full of her bloodlines.Her offsping can be seen on the farm. Bred to Sombrero for 2010,Star is for sale at $2,500.

Lavender Lady clrc#37305

Lavender is a very popular alpaca in all ways.She is easy to handle and great at school visits. She has great stature and a lot of fleece, which carries a rich fawn lustre and has produced a fabulous yarn for us this year which is in great demand from our clients. She was shown at Alpaca Ontario in 2009. The judge pulled her to the front before anything else , but in the end moved her back down the line to sixth. We were extremely disappointed as we felt she was our best hope of the year, ironically we came away with 5 ribbons from other classes. Go figure! She remains an outstanding alpaca, and was bred in the fall to Tucker for a 2010 cria. Lavender is for sale for $3,500.

Johanna Little Lady clrc # 37302

Johanna is a very strong and athletic animal, and she has produced a fabulous yarn this year. She is a little fractious and headstrong, and we would expect her to be a herd matriarch one day. She bred often and very willingly with Tucker in the early part of last summer,a first time experience for them both, so we fully expect a 2010 cria, with every chance that it will be a grey with the same supersoft handle of the parents. Johanna is for sale for $4,000.
